Okay, I have my non 3G Kindle in front of me. I don't have a wireless connection at home.

I have the USB plugged into the Kindle and my computer. The green light is on, which (according to the user guide) means that it's fully charged. However, the screen says it's in "USB Drive Mode" and that it's charging.

If I try ejecting it, that screen goes away but the "Kindle" folder on my computer goes away too. I want to transfer the books I bought to the Kindle but I can't for the life of me figure out how.

If you double click on the kindle folder in my computer, it should open and show a document folder. Just either drag your book file to the document folder or cut and paste.
